The Pendleton city manager has lost control of his staff. There were broken promises by city officials to eliminate “bulb-out” corners on the redesign of Despain Avenue, the over-restrictive rewrite of the sign ordinance eliminating types of signs that have been an integral part of our downtown for decades, and this latest storm trooper approach to force building owners to fill empty store front or face punitive action.
We still have chronically homeless sleeping on city sidewalks, derelict buildings, the Edwards Apartments that has been eyesore for decades and residences such as the infamous house on Southwest Eighth Street that reduce property values in that neighborhood. The deplorable conditions in Sargent City also come to mind. It’s time for the city manager to step up and take control, to address the real problems that continue to plague our city and let the downtown property owners take care of themselves.
